Material Specification for Tl:2212; [Tl-Ba-Ca-Cu-O]
Process: Solid State Reaction
Notes: "... single crystals were grown... Powders of BaO, Ca, CuO, and Tl2O3 mixed in appropriate ratio were prebaked at 650 °C for half an hour and then heated to 960 °C for thorough reaction. After slowly cooling to room temperature, crystals of generally...(0.2 x 0.2 x 0.04)mm3 in size were obtained."
Formula: Tl2Ba2CaCu2O8
Informal Name: Tl:2212
Chemical Family: Tl-Ba-Ca-Cu-O
Chemical Class: Oxide
Structure Type: Single Crystal

Measurement Method: Thermopower method
The authors cite L. Li et al., Europhys. Lett., Vol. 7, 555 (1988), and summarize the procedure as follows. "At very constant reference temperature a voltage difference was recorded in response to a sweeping temperature differential monitored by a constantan-copper thermocouple, which resulted in a satisfactory straight line (except at the superconducting transition) without thermal hysteresis. The slope, normalized to the sensitivity of the constantan-copper thermocouple, gives the thermopower of the sample after correcting the contribution of electric leads."
